The Ohio Credit Union League is currently seeking a program manager who is a highly motivated self-starter and is excited to join a fun, fast-paced, dynamic trade association. The Program Manager will be responsible for the strategic planning, development, and execution of a wide range of League and Foundation programs and events that shape the professional development landscape of credit union professionals. This dynamic position works collaboratively with different teams to create valuable networking opportunities, educational initiatives, and engaging experiences for credit union leaders and business partners. Additionally, this position advances the Ohio Credit Union Foundation's mission by overseeing its grants program.

The Ohio Credit Union League is proud to be the state trade association for Ohios credit unions. We make their daily lives easier through political and regulatory advocacy, compliance and information services, educational and professional development opportunities, communications, media relations, outreach solutions, and more.
